Talking Need a new remote control, mine stopped working

I have a 98 ml320 and my remote does not work. I have tried re-programming it with the manual that it came with, but it just doesn't work. What else can I do, without spending toms of $? I saw some new and used remotes on Ebay, and they say that all you ahve to do is program it, but I don't know how true that is, without going to the dealer. Also, the panel screen that shows how many miles are left, you know, the one with the timer, also has a clock feature, doesn't it? How can I set the time? That info is not in the manual. Also, the clock on the dash and the outside temp light area thing on the dash is not lighting up light. How can I get it to light up the same way the mileage one does? Someone, please help me from spending lots of money at a service station to help me.
Thanks...I'm a newbie!

First the key - Try changing the battery - mine goes out once a year so I think you should try that first.

As far as the manual, you can download one online at MBUSA .com after creating a profile.

The color of tint of the lights are guided by bulbs behind the dashplate, there is a DIY instruction set on this forum, use the search feature and enter "dash lights"

The Trip computer (on the roof) does not have a CLOCK feature but a timer. it does have a average total mileage meter, a current average milage meter, gas miles left based on fuel remaining (which for you will be off because of the larger rims), and lastly it has a calender.

I hope this helps and welcome to the forum!!

NOW the bad part, you have 22" rims but are being frugal with repairs - you are going to be in for a shocker, this car is expensive to keep up, i'd scrap the rims and see if you can get some coverage for major repairs.
